﻿
body {
    color: #333;
    font: 14px/1.8em "lucida grande", "lucida sans unicode", lucida, helvetica, "Hiragino Sans GB", "Microsoft YaHei", "WenQuanYi Micro Hei", sans-serif;
    line-height: 25px;
    font-weight: 400;
}
.a-logo {
    margin:20px auto;
}
.a-search {
    padding-top:20px;
}
.a-search-keys {
    padding-top:5px;
}
.a-search-keys a {
    margin-right:10px;
    color:#777;
}
.a-news:hover {
    cursor: pointer;
    color: #1da4e5;
}
.a-news a {
    text-decoration:none;
}
    .a-news:hover .text-muted {
        color: #1da4e5;
    }

.carousel-inner .carousel-caption p {
    background-color: #000;
    filter: alpha(opacity:60);
    opacity: 0.6;
}
/* Image blocks */
.hover-block .hove-block-li {
    margin-bottom: 15px;
}
    .hover-block .hove-block-li a {
        position: relative;
        overflow: hidden;
        height: 165px;
        color: #000;
    }
    .hover-block .hove-block-li .hover-content {
        position: absolute;
        z-index: 1000;
        height: 165px;
        top: 125px;
        color: #fff;
        padding: 10px;
    }
    .hover-block .hove-block-li a:hover .hover-content {
        top: 0px;
        padding: 10px;
    }
/* Background colors */

.b-orange {
    background: #fe781e;
    color: #fff;
    margin: 3px 0px;
    display: inline-block;
    -webkit-transition: background 1s ease;
    -moz-transition: background 1s ease;
    -o-transition: background 1s ease;
    transition: background 1s ease;
    cursor: default;
}

    .b-orange:hover {
        background: #e66d1c;
        -webkit-transition: background 1s ease;
        -moz-transition: background 1s ease;
        -o-transition: background 1s ease;
        transition: background 1s ease;
    }

.b-purple {
    background: #9b59bb;
    color: #fff;
    margin: 3px 0px;
    display: inline-block;
    -webkit-transition: background 1s ease;
    -moz-transition: background 1s ease;
    -o-transition: background 1s ease;
    transition: background 1s ease;
    cursor: default;
}

    .b-purple:hover {
        background: #81499c;
        -webkit-transition: background 1s ease;
        -moz-transition: background 1s ease;
        -o-transition: background 1s ease;
        transition: background 1s ease;
    }

.b-blue {
    background: #1570a6;
    color: #fff;
    margin: 3px 0px;
    display: inline-block;
    -webkit-transition: background 1s ease;
    -moz-transition: background 1s ease;
    -o-transition: background 1s ease;
    transition: background 1s ease;
    cursor: default;
}

    .b-blue:hover {
        background: #11608f;
        -webkit-transition: background 1s ease;
        -moz-transition: background 1s ease;
        -o-transition: background 1s ease;
        transition: background 1s ease;
    }

.b-green {
    background: #41bb19;
    color: #fff;
    margin: 3px 0px;
    display: inline-block;
    -webkit-transition: background 1s ease;
    -moz-transition: background 1s ease;
    -o-transition: background 1s ease;
    transition: background 1s ease;
    cursor: default;
}

    .b-green:hover {
        background: #379e15;
        -webkit-transition: background 1s ease;
        -moz-transition: background 1s ease;
        -o-transition: background 1s ease;
        transition: background 1s ease;
    }

.b-black {
    background: #333333;
    color: #fff;
    margin: 3px 0px;
    display: inline-block;
    -webkit-transition: background 1s ease;
    -moz-transition: background 1s ease;
    -o-transition: background 1s ease;
    transition: background 1s ease;
    cursor: default;
}

    .b-black:hover {
        background: #000000;
        -webkit-transition: background 1s ease;
        -moz-transition: background 1s ease;
        -o-transition: background 1s ease;
        transition: background 1s ease;
    }

.b-lblue {
    background: #1ba1e2;
    color: #fff;
    margin: 3px 0px;
    display: inline-block;
    -webkit-transition: background 1s ease;
    -moz-transition: background 1s ease;
    -o-transition: background 1s ease;
    transition: background 1s ease;
    cursor: default;
}

    .b-lblue:hover {
        background: #1789c1;
        -webkit-transition: background 1s ease;
        -moz-transition: background 1s ease;
        -o-transition: background 1s ease;
        transition: background 1s ease;
    }

.b-red {
    background: #ff3738;
    color: #fff;
    margin: 3px 0px;
    display: inline-block;
    -webkit-transition: background 1s ease;
    -moz-transition: background 1s ease;
    -o-transition: background 1s ease;
    transition: background 1s ease;
    cursor: default;
}

    .b-red:hover {
        background: #e33031;
        -webkit-transition: background 1s ease;
        -moz-transition: background 1s ease;
        -o-transition: background 1s ease;
        transition: background 1s ease;
    }
.a-link img{
    margin:5px auto;
}
/* Footer */
footer{
	font-size: 13px;
	background: #f6f6f6;
	color: #444;
    margin-top:30px;
    padding-top:20px;
}
footer a{
	color: #777;
}
footer a:hover{
	color: #666;
}
footer ul{
	list-style: none;
	padding:0;
    margin:0;
}
footer ul li{
	padding: 3px 0px;
}
footer .a-copy{
	background-color:#eee;
    border-top: 1px solid #ddd;
	padding: 10px 0px;
    margin-top:20px;
}

.yes {
    background: url(../images/yes.gif) no-repeat right bottom;
}

.myinfo {
    text-align: center;
}

    .myinfo a:hover {
        text-decoration: none;
    }

    .myinfo a div {
        height: 80px;
        line-height: 80px;
        font-size: 32px;
        color: #FFF;
        font-weight: bold;
    }

.sms1 {
    background: url(../images/app/sms_1.gif) no-repeat center;
}

.sms2 {
    background: url(../images/app/sms_2.gif) no-repeat center;
}

.sms3 {
    background: url(../images/app/sms_3.gif) no-repeat center;
}

.sms6 {
    background: url(../images/app/sms_6.gif) no-repeat center;
}

.smsexmail {
    background: url(../images/app/exmail.png) no-repeat center;
}

.smsnote img {
    width: 100px;
}

/*afeng 2018-12-27*/
.yoa-banner-bg {
    background:url(../images/banner.jpg) no-repeat top left #fff;
}
.yoa-banner-bg1 {
    background:url(../images/banner1.jpg) no-repeat top left #fff;
}
.yoa-banner-bg2 {
    background:url(../images/banner2.jpg) no-repeat top left #fff;
}
.yoa-banner-bg3 {
    background:url(../images/banner3.jpg) no-repeat top left #fff;
}
.yoa-banner-bg4 {
    background:url(../images/banner4.jpg) no-repeat top left #fff;
}
.yoa-left-line {
    border-left:1px solid #eee;
}
.yoa-info-note {
    font-size:20px;
    line-height:1.8;
    font-family:STFangsong,STSong;
}
